Might loss of life row inmate reopen habeas case if lawyer abandons him? ABA urges SCOTUS to resolve

The ABA has filed an amicus temporary urging the U.S. Supreme Court docket to listen to the case of a loss of life row inmate whose appointed habeas lawyer “functionally” deserted him.

The ABA’s Oct. 30 amicus brief asks the Supreme Court docket to grant cert within the case of Joseph Gamboa of Texas, in line with an ABA press release.

Gamboa’s appointed habeas lawyer advised Gamboa that he thought that he was responsible, failed to research info or develop authorized claims, and carried out a day of authorized analysis, in line with Gamboa’s cert petition.

After “nearly no work on the case,” the habeas lawyer “filed a sham petition containing seven
claims copied and pasted from the petition of one other consumer,” the cert petition says. The claims “contained generic, legally foreclosed challenges to the Texas loss of life penalty scheme” and even used the opposite’s consumer’s identify within the prayer for aid.

The habeas lawyer then conceded that Gamboa’s claims had been foreclosed after the state answered Gamboa’s petition. The concession was filed previous the deadline. Gamboa filed a professional se movement for brand spanking new counsel. The fifth U.S. Circuit Court docket of Appeals at New Orleans denied Gamboa’s movement, together with the habeas petition.

Precedent within the fifth Circuit holds that Federal Rule of Civil Process 60(b) can’t be used to reopen a habeas continuing, even when an inmate’s lawyer has deserted him. Three different federal appeals courts have reached a opposite conclusion in circumstances of lawyer abandonment, the ABA factors out in its amicus temporary.

Supreme Court docket assessment “is required to make sure uniformity of federal habeas administration within the decrease courts and to keep away from unjust and pointless penalties when lawyer misconduct rises to the extent of abandonment,” the ABA temporary says. “The fifth Circuit’s harsh rule poses a novel menace to the legitimacy of the capital system.”

Federal legislation grants habeas petitioners a proper to counsel with better expertise in capital circumstances, reflecting the intention of offering basic equity, in line with the ABA temporary. The ABA additionally seeks to make sure high-quality illustration in its Loss of life Penalty Pointers, which set out a nationwide commonplace of observe in capital circumstances.

Underneath the rules, the duties of capital counsel embody an aggressive investigation, litigation of all “arguably meritorious” points, shut contact with the consumer on litigation developments, and formation of an applicable protection staff.

Assuming that Gamboa’s allegations are true, “counsel departed so utterly from the prevailing requirements for capital illustration set out within the tips that he did not act as Mr. Gamboa’s consultant,” the ABA temporary says.

Gamboa is represented by attorneys from Federal Defender Companies of Japanese Tennessee and Arnold & Porter Kaye Scholer. Kellogg, Hansen, Todd, Figel & Frederick filed the amicus temporary professional bono on behalf of the ABA.

The case is Gamboa v. Lumpkin.
